Chelsea midfielder Moises Caicedo has been named in Ecuador’s squad for the 2026 FIFA World Cup, as the South American side prepares for the tournament in the United States, Canada and Mexico. As reported by BBC Sport on Monday, the 23-year-old is one of Ecuador’s most important players and will feature at his second consecutive World Cup, having also been part of the national team at the previous edition. Caicedo’s inclusion highlights Ecuador’s strong core of Europe-based players as they aim to make a deeper run in the competition this time around. He is joined in the squad by Arsenal defender Piero Hincapie, who will also be making his second World Cup appearance. The defensive duo are expected to play key roles for Ecuador as they look to compete in a tough group. Veteran striker and captain Enner Valencia has also been selected. The 36-year-old, Ecuador’s all-time leading scorer with 49 goals in 105 appearances, will be appearing at his third World Cup. Sunderland forward Nilson Angulo has earned his first World Cup call-up following his January move from Anderlecht, adding fresh attacking options to the squad. Former Brighton defender Pervis Estupiñán, now with AC Milan, is also included, along with Chelsea teenager Kendry Páez, currently on loan at River Plate. Ecuador will be hoping to improve on their best-ever World Cup performance, which came in 2006 when they reached the round of 16. They will then face Curaçao on June 21 before concluding their group matches against Germany at MetLife Stadium in New Jersey on June 25. Ecuador World Cup squad Goalkeepers: Hernan Galindez (Huracan), Moises Ramirez (Kifisia), Gonzalo Valle (LDU Quito). Defenders: Piero Hincapie (Arsenal), Willian Pacho (Paris St-Germain), Pervis Estupinan (AC Milan), Felix Torres (Internacional), Joel Ordonez (Club Brugge), Jackson Porozo (Tijuana), Angelo Preciado (Atletico Mineiro). Midfielders: Moises Caicedo (Chelsea), Alan Franco (Atletico Mineiro), Kendry Paez (River Plate, on loan from Chelsea), Pedro Vite (UNAM), Jordy Alcivar (Independiente del Valle), Denil Castillo (Midtjylland), Yaimar Medina (Genk).
